Should I Hire A Private Investigator?

There are several reasons why hiring a Private Investigator (PI) in the DFW area could prove beneficial to your divorce, especially in the case of a complicated split.


The more detailed the evidence is, the more likely a judge is to be swayed one direction or the other.


In some cases spouses will hide assets and or lie about their income and or employment status in order to keep those assets or finances out of consideration in a divorce settlement. A PI may also help bring those situations to light. If you suspect that your spouse may be hiding substantial assets or income that outweighs the cost of a PI, then it may be worth pursuing.


In general it’s a good idea to have hired and consulted with an attorney before reaching out to a PI. An attorney can help you determine whether a PI is a good investment in your specific situation.
